This comment supports adoption of the guidelines, while recommending 5 improvements. First,

ICANN org should publish a sequenced implementation roadmap that identifies priority

dependencies, delivery owners and review points. Second, the proposed measurement

framework should be converted into a baseline assessment, a public dashboard and a periodic

reporting cycle. Third, ICANN should use mission-consistent incentives, model procurementapproaches and existing technical resources to accelerate adoption without bypassing

bottom-up processes. Fourth, implementation should more explicitly involve civil society, end

users, minority language communities and underserved regions. Fifth, accessibility, security and

privacy should be treated as core UA requirements rather than secondary considerations.
